We are visiting Dec 1-12 & plan on a trip to Universal - DS is a huge HP fan! Does anyone have experience of how busy it is - whether buying the express pass is worthwhile, or the food pass?

We havent been to Universal for about 6 years :confused3 its all changed now!!

Also - one day or 2??

One of the least crowded times of the year. Express almost certainly not needed, definitely wait to decide until there to see for yourself. No experience with meal deal, but that's because most here advise against it. Two days, one per park.
 
I was there last year Dec 1-4, first half of each day I would ride and get right back on again with little wait. As the day goes the lines did start to form but not more than a 20 minute or so wait.
I spent about $20 a day at the park for eats; counter service, churros (love them), drinks, and so on. Ate breakfast in my room (had a fridge), and had dinner (The Three Broomsticks) once in the park.
The number of days is at least 2 if you can't manage more.
Also look for a posting that mentions the short cut to WWHP. It really is shorter, I use it everytime.
